Ace Your Next Text-Based Interview via Skype: A Comprehensive Guide
Understanding Text-Based Interviews
- **Flexibility:** Text-based interviews allow both parties to engage at a comfortable pace.
- **Record Keeping:** Conversations can be easily saved for future reference.
- **Reduced Pressure:** Candidates often feel less anxious without the need to maintain eye contact or manage body language.
Preparing for a Text-Based Interview on Skype
- **Profile Setup:** Ensure your Skype profile is professional. Use a clear, professional photo and a username that includes your name.
- **Technical Check:** Test your internet connection, and make sure Skype is updated to the latest version. Familiarize yourself with its features, including chat functions and settings.
- **Research the Company:** Understand the company’s mission, values, and recent news. Tailor your responses to align with the company culture.
- **Practice Typing:** Speed and accuracy are crucial. Practice typing responses to common interview questions to enhance your typing skills.
- **Prepare Your Environment:** Choose a quiet, distraction-free space. Ensure good lighting and a neutral background to maintain professionalism.
Strategies for Successful Engagement
- **Be Concise:** Keep your answers clear and to the point. Avoid long-winded responses that can lose the interviewer’s interest.
- **Use Proper Grammar:** Take the time to proofread your responses for spelling and grammatical errors before sending them.
- **Ask Clarifying Questions:** If a question is unclear, don’t hesitate to ask for clarification. This shows attentiveness and ensures you provide relevant answers.
- **Maintain a Professional Tone:** Use formal language, and avoid slang or overly casual expressions.
- **Highlight Your Skills:** Clearly articulate how your skills and experience align with the job requirements. Use specific examples to demonstrate your competencies.
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them
- **Lack of Non-Verbal Cues:** Without visual cues, it can be hard to gauge the interviewer’s reaction. Focus on clear and expressive language to convey enthusiasm.
- **Time Management:** It can be tempting to spend too long on each response. Keep track of time to ensure you finish within the allotted period.
- **Technical Glitches:** Prepare for potential technical issues by having a backup plan, such as an alternative communication method.
